Transaction 24ea15024cb6fe6234a95af92e86fc8bdd4d7c9879fc89bbf8ef7dc4a0abf04c

2 Input
2 Outputs
  • 24ea15024cb6fe6234a95af92e86fc8bdd4d7c9879fc89bbf8ef7dc4a0abf04c:0
  • value  37581887
    address  1HcAWTXnLfyc81FukuxmXkdtr26K6bU6jB
  • 24ea15024cb6fe6234a95af92e86fc8bdd4d7c9879fc89bbf8ef7dc4a0abf04c:1
  • value  99200000
    address  1DSRrtter1nFfagshUwjN7XnmjSzRhvk61